Campanian DOC (1995) on the Amalfi Coast on vertiginous terraces facing the Mediterranean, sub-zones Furore, Ravello and Tramonti. Falanghina and Biancolella are the white signatures: dry and structured with notes of citrus, apple, white flowers, Mediterranean herbs and a saline touch, good aging potential. Aglianico and Piedirosso are the red signatures blended with Sciascinoso: fruity with cherry, berries, geranium and peppery touch, supple tannins. Manual harvesting compulsory.

Powerful, tannic reds with deep colour and tight structure, with aromas of black cherry, blackberry, leather, tobacco, coffee and balsamic-volcanic mineral notes. High acidity and very fine ageing potential, often compared to nebbiolo. Star of Taurasi DOCG in Campania and Aglianico del Vulture DOCG in Basilicata (vines planted on volcanic soils). Late-ripening southern Italian variety of probable ancient Greek origin.

Supple, fruity reds with a clear to intense ruby robe, smooth tannins and a charming palate, with signature aromas of red fruits (cherry, raspberry), plum, spices, Mediterranean garrigue and volcanic mineral notes. Sunny Campanian profile for early drinking or short ageing. Essential component of Lacryma Christi del Vesuvio DOC and star of Campanian DOC reds (Ischia, Capri). Indigenous Italian black variety from Campania.
